Paris: A Timeless Tale of History, Culture, and Transformation

Paris, a city celebrated worldwide for its romance, art, and culture, boasts a history that spans centuries, reflecting humanity’s triumphs, struggles, and creative evolution. What began as a small village has grown into one of the most iconic and beautiful cities on Earth, a testament to its enduring allure and significance.

The story of Paris dates back to around 250 BCE, when a settlement known as *Lutetia* was established along the banks of the Seine River. This strategic location laid the foundation for the city’s future prominence. During the Roman era, Lutetia flourished as a vital trading hub, with the Romans constructing bridges, roads, and buildings that provided the city with a robust infrastructure.

By the Middle Ages, Paris had emerged as the political, religious, and cultural heart of France. The 12th century saw the construction of the Notre-Dame Cathedral, a masterpiece of Gothic architecture that became a symbol of the city’s spiritual and artistic identity. This period also marked the founding of the University of Paris, one of the oldest universities in the world, which turned the city into a beacon of learning and intellectual discourse.

The 18th century brought seismic changes with the French Revolution, a pivotal moment that reshaped Paris and the nation. The fall of the monarchy and the rise of democracy marked a new chapter in the city’s history. Following the revolution, Napoleon Bonaparte took the reins of power, initiating ambitious urban projects, including the construction of the Arc de Triomphe, which stands as a testament to his vision of a modern Paris.

The 19th century witnessed another transformative phase under Baron Haussmann, whose urban renewal plan redefined the city. Haussmann’s vision included widening streets, creating new parks, and modernizing buildings, all aimed at making Paris more organized, hygienic, and aesthetically pleasing. These changes not only enhanced the city’s beauty but also laid the groundwork for its future as a global metropolis.

The 20th century brought both turmoil and cultural renaissance. Paris endured the devastation of two World Wars, including occupation by Nazi forces during World War II. Yet, even in the face of adversity, the city remained a hub of art, literature, and philosophy. Visionaries like Picasso, Hemingway, and Sartre found inspiration in its streets, leaving an indelible mark on global culture.

Today, Paris stands as a modern metropolis that seamlessly blends its rich history with contemporary innovation. Its museums, galleries, and historic landmarks continue to draw millions of visitors each year. Iconic sites such as the Eiffel Tower, the Louvre Museum, and Notre-Dame Cathedral are celebrated worldwide, embodying the city’s timeless appeal.

The history of Paris is more than just the story of a city; it is a reflection of humanity’s progress, resilience, and creativity. As it strides into the future, Paris remains a dream destination, a place where the past and present coexist in perfect harmony, captivating the hearts of people across the globe.
